Numbers 32:32 Meaning and Commentary

Numbers 32:32

We will pass over armed before the Lord into the land of
Canaan
This is repeated again and again, for the confirmation of it, assuring that it should be strictly performed according to the true intent of it:

that the possession of our inheritance on this side Jordan may be ours;
that is, that the possession and inheritance they desired, and which had been granted them, on conditions to be performed by them, might be ratified and confirmed unto them on their fulfilment of them.

Numbers 32:32 In-Context

30 But if they do not arm themselves and go across with you, then they must accept their possession among you in the land of Canaan.”
31 The Gadites and Reubenites replied, “As the LORD has spoken to your servants, so we will do.
32 We will cross over into the land of Canaan armed before the LORD, that we may have our inheritance on this side of the Jordan.”
33 So Moses gave to the Gadites, to the Reubenites, and to the half-tribe of Manasseh son of Joseph the kingdom of Sihon king of the Amorites and the kingdom of Og king of Bashan—the land including its cities and the territory surrounding them.
34 And the Gadites built up Dibon, Ataroth, Aroer,
